archive_write_set_passphrase - functions for writing encrypted archives


ARCHIVE_WRITE_SET_PASSPH(3) Library Functions ManualARCHIVE_WRITE_SET_PASSPH(3)

NAME

archive_write_set_passphrase, archive_write_set_passphrase_callback — functions for writing encrypted archives

LIBRARY

Streaming Archive Library (libarchive, -larchive)

SYNOPSIS

#include <archive.h>

int

archive_write_set_passphrase(struct archive *, const char *passphrase);

int

archive_write_set_passphrase_callback(struct archive *, void *client_data, archive_passphrase_callback *);

DESCRIPTION
archive_write_set_passphrase
()

Set a passphrase for writing an encrypted archive. If passphrase is NULL or empty, this function will do nothing and ARCHIVE_FAILED will be returned. Otherwise, ARCHIVE_OK will be returned.

archive_write_set_passphrase_callback()

Register a callback function that will be invoked to get a passphrase for encryption if the passphrase was not set by the archive_write_set_passphrase() function.

SEE ALSO

tar(1), archive_write(3), archive_write_set_options(3), libarchive(3) GNU September 21, 2014ARCHIVE_WRITE_SET_PASSPHRASE(3)


Updated 2024-01-29 - jenkler.se | uex.se